Output cc83fb1cd36c430653f578231189b80e1088ea44d51c1ce4a3478ce9ef10a1c3:29

value
1197582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f833ef5dbaeb3153842a43feec7f2c491c0580e OP_EQUAL
address
37Uqikr4gNzwAC6CsYmopRUMxbcd8TYDFD
transaction
cc83fb1cd36c430653f578231189b80e1088ea44d51c1ce4a3478ce9ef10a1c3
confirmations
252748
spent
true